Definition and Role
Piston rod welded hydraulic cylinders are hydraulic actuators used to create linear motion in a hydraulic system. They consist of a piston rod attached to a piston, which moves back and forth within a cylindrical barrel to generate force.
Principle and Application
These cylinders operate based on Pascal’s law, where pressure applied to the piston is transmitted through the hydraulic fluid to create movement. They find applications in construction equipment, manufacturing machinery, agricultural vehicles, transportation systems, mining machinery, aerospace, and aviation.
